The Technical Roadmap to Industry 4.0

The journey from manual Saldatura Al Tig to fully integrated robotic cladding stations involves several critical technological leaps. Our roadmap focuses on:

Feature Conventional TIG Plasma Cladding (PTA) Laser Cladding
Deposition Rate Low High (2-12 kg/h) Medium-High
Dilution Rate 5-15% 5-10% < 5% (Superior)
Metallurgical Bond Excellent Excellent Superior
Automation Manual/Semi Fully Automated Robotic Integration

Frequently Asked Questions (FAQ)

What is the main advantage of Plasma Cladding over traditional TIG welding?

While Saldatura Al Tig offers high precision, Plasma Cladding (PTA) provides a much higher deposition rate and a more concentrated arc, leading to a smaller heat-affected zone and superior metallurgical bonding for wear-resistant layers.

How does the dilution rate affect the quality of the overlay?

Dilution rate is critical in hardfacing. A lower dilution rate (achievable via our Laser and Plasma systems) means the alloy powder retains its original properties better, providing superior protection without being "watered down" by the base metal.
